About this course

Analyzing complex engineering structures requires moving beyond simple single-degree-of-freedom models to understand how real-world systems vibrate and respond to forces. This written course provides a clear, step-by-step guide to mastering Multi-Degree-of-Freedom (MDoF) systems, equipping you with the essential mathematical and analytical tools used by structural and mechanical engineers.\n\nYou will transition from basic physical principles to formulating equations of motion for complex systems, decoupling them for easier analysis, and solving both free and forced vibration scenarios.\n\nWhat you'll learn:\n- Formulate mathematical equations of motion for multi-degree-of-freedom systems using mass, stiffness, and damping matrices\n- Decouple complex equations of motion using modal analysis and eigenvalue problems to simplify calculations\n- Calculate natural frequencies and mode shapes to predict how a system will vibrate naturally\n- Solve free vibration response of MDoF systems under various initial conditions\n- Analyze forced vibration response under harmonic and dynamic loading conditions\n- Understand modern numerical evaluation techniques and state-space formulations used in computational structural dynamics\n\nThe course begins with foundational definitions and key terminology of multi-degree-of-freedom dynamics, gradually advancing through matrix formulation, modal decoupling, and practical solution techniques for real-world engineering problems. Designed specifically for beginners, this course requires only a basic background in calculus and linear algebra, with no prior advanced dynamics experience needed.
